eatyo wrote:

Berserker Greaves should never be a option for any champion in my opinion other boots offer to much for what little you get with those. Since ashe is squishy if you dont get swift boots, I'd say only other option really is mercury tread's.


Ashe is ranged and can slow enemies up to 35% for 2 seconds each shot, volley slows enemies just the same, with a good combination of frost shot to gain a little distance and the enemy walking into valley you could escape just as easily as with the swift boots. Add ghost to that combo and you're well on your way out of danger. I think that if you're a good player, you won't need the extra speed because of those two abilities. The main idea behind the greaves is that the attack speed on these babies improves your ability to farm early game, for 150 extra gold after a dagger. Alternatively, though, you could turn the boots of speed into boots of swiftness, and get a dagger, which would later on build into Black Cleaver, you would need to farm additional 200 gold before you return for your shoes and brutalizer though. I will test this out and see how it works.

Tested and it seems to work out great. Thanks for your opinion, I'm going to add this option to the item variations.


B-Wong wrote:

That is the latest Infinity Edge on a standard build for Ashe I've ever seen. You may want to get it as a priority for your items because it's such a linchpin to Ashe's success.

Infinity Edge is a great item, but its cost really bugs me. The Black Cleaver adds the speed and damage you need in mid game, also providing you with an amazing passive, all that at a 1000 gold less. Infinity Edge is a good choice, but it shouldn't be rushed until after the the Cleaver, because the Cleaver builds your farming capabilities. That would replace the Bloodthirster, but as an alternative to the life leech, you could get a 2nd scythe until you gather enough gold to buy it. Doing this, however, could lower your damage output as you're basing your damage on luck that you will crit. While with the crits, you could whip people, without them the Bloodthirster with 40 kills would be a better choice, giving your Ashe 100 damage and 35 life leech. I will test this alternative out and see how it goes.
